It should not have happened in the inaugural year of the 12-team College Football Playoff; however, a certain Southeastern Conference school got Alabama’s attention last season.
The moment came the week following Kalen DeBoer and the Crimson Tide feeling very good about its victory over Georgia on Saban Field at Bryant-Denny Stadium.

DeBoer got his first win over Kirby Smart and Nick Saban was in attendance. He felt as though he had arrived as the next great SEC head coach, yet the tables quickly turned. No one thought anything of Vanderbilt heading into its matchup against Alabama. In fact, the biggest thought was how badly would the Commodores lose at home. Vandy had one player that talked moderate trash about the Tide in 2017, and Alabama gave it a 59-0 woodshed beating.
DeBoer got shocked by the ‘Dores in 2024 as the fighters of Nashville (Tenn.) got a 40-35 victory over Alabama with a transfer portal quarterback. Diego Pavia is back for another season at Vanderbilt, but the Tide is not overlooking Vandy this time. Ryan Williams, now at 18 years old, looks forward to his sophomore matchup against the Commodores in Tuscaloosa, Ala.
He did not mince words in his conversation with former NFL head coach, Jon Gruden when it comes this year’s contest against Vanderbilt.

“They [Vanderbilt] played a better game than us in this football game,” Williams said about what happened to Alabama in 2024 versus Vandy. “We came out slow and they capitalized. They held the ball, they had their game plan, and they executed. But going into this game, we don’t call them revenge games. We are going to kill an ant with a sledgehammer this year.”
Williams said every team Alabama loss to in 2024 it has a ‘red eye’ on them this time.
